☐ Landlord site audit — heads up! Brindlewick Estates is doing their quarterly walkthrough of the Copperfield Annex on your first day, so expect clipboard people roaming the corridors. Your job: make sure all fire doors on level 2 are unpropped before 9am and the storage cage by the loading bay is locked. If the auditor asks anything tricky, wave them over to the facilities desk — don't improvise. You'll need access to the cage and plant room, so use the pass below.

turnstile pass: bdg-YPPQB-52010

Since rolling out Schedulyn 4.2, several tenants have reported nightly jobs firing up to ninety seconds late. The drift traces back to the beacon host in the Varport cluster syncing against a stale time source after failover. Support should confirm drift by comparing the job ledger's scheduled_at and fired_at columns before escalating to the platform team. Anything above thirty seconds warrants a ticket. To run the comparison query yourself, connect to the scheduler ledger database using the connection string below.

warehouse DSN: mssql://rusdor_svc:0FSWCn9@db-951a.paliqforge.local:5432/ulawyn

# Provenance: Hermetic Build Migration

Quick notes for the release manager: we've moved Pellgrove's main pipeline onto the hermetic Kilnworks build system. Upshot — no more network fetches mid-build, all deps pinned in the lockstore, and outputs are bit-for-bit reproducible. Provenance attestations now come for free; each artifact ships with a signed manifest. Old non-hermetic builds stay queryable through Q2, then get archived. To verify any release, compare its manifest against the token below.

session token of tajef-bageg = htk21_5d90d574934f3ccae6437

## Authentication

The Quillstack autoscaler polls queue depth from the Brimwater broker every ten seconds and adjusts worker counts accordingly. All API calls to the broker's metrics endpoint require a service credential scoped to read-only metrics. Store it in the autoscaler's environment, never in the repo. For local development, use the key below.

gateway credential: kto23_LX9A4ys6i4nzHtpOLNLodKK